Understanding Your GiftTGIF Today God Is First Volume 1, by Os Hillman
02-05-2012
Now about spiritual gifts, brothers, I do not want you to be ignorant. - 1 Corinthians 12:1
In
First Corinthians 12 and Romans 12, the apostle Paul is teaching us
about the role of spiritual gifts in the Church. He correlates these
gifts to a human body, telling us that each person's gift helps the
whole Body of the Church. This is such an important principle for us to
learn. I must say I learned this principle regarding my own spiritual
gift the hard way.
"God
will never speak as strongly to you as to someone else," said my mentor
to me one day. The statement shocked me. "What in the world do you mean
by that?" I argued with him.
"Your
spiritual gift of administration/leading is one of the most dangerous
gifts in the whole Body of Christ. The reason is that you can see the
big picture better than anyone else, and you're so task-oriented that
you will run people into the ground getting your project completed
because you think you see it so clearly. That is why the best friend you
could ever have is someone with a prophetic gift to discern whether the
big picture you see is actually the picture God is directing. It is the
one gift that can almost stand alone better than any other - at least
that is the opinion of the one with that gift."
Oh,
how I have learned this lesson the hard way! He was so right. There
have been many a church staff destroyed by a person with the gift of
administration. During my years as an ad agency owner, I saw how I
stressed out my staff because of the tremendous load I put on them with
multiple projects. It was so easy for me because the more balls I had
juggling, the better I felt. I was oblivious to how my multi-task
personality impacted those around me.
Today,
I have some special relationships with intercessors and prophetic
people whom I depend on for confirmation of direction. I have learned
their spiritual gifts of discernment are of great value in determining
strategic direction. I have learned that God has placed within each
person a spiritual gift that is designed to make the Body of Christ
function better for His purposes. When we discover the spiritual gifts
God has placed in those around us, we are better able to see the Body
function as a real body-totally dependent on one another. Some of us are
more sensitive to God's voice because God has gifted us in that way.
Others of us are less sensitive because God wants us to depend on others
in the Body for their gifts. Find out whom God has placed around you
today and discover a new dimension of spiritual productivity.
